Mobile communications has created a major breakthrough in new telecom
services worldwide during the last decade. It is expected that the number
of global mobile connections exceed the number of fixed connections in
the next five-year period. At the same time, the new IMT2000 compatible
Third Generation (3G) broadband networks and services will be available.
The data service breakthrough enabled by Internet will create new
possibilities for mobile and wireless services. A lot of research is also
targeted to wireless Internet services and IP-mobility.

The Personal Wireless Communications PWC'2002 conference belongs to an
IFIP workshop and conference series arranged by IFIP TC-6 Working Group
6.8. The previous events were held in preceding years at Prague, Tokyo,
Frankfurt, Copenhagen, Gdansk and Lappeenranta in Finland. The PWC'2002
event will be held in Singapore.
